η-Cyclopentadienylimido molybdenum chemistry: hydrido, alkyl and η-alkyl derivatives
Abstract
The following compounds have been prepared and characterized: [Mo(η-C5H4R)Cl3(NBut)](R = H, Me or Pri), [{MoCl3(µ-Cl)(NBut)}2], cis- and trans-[{Mo(η-C5H4Me)(NBut)(µ-NBut)}2], [{Mo(η-C5H4Me)O(µ-NBut)}2], [Mo(η-C5H4Me)(η-C2H4)Me(NBut)], [Mo(η-C5H5)(η-C2H4)Ph(NBut)], [Mo-(η-C6H4Me)(η-C2H4)(H or D)(NBut)], [Mo(η-C5H4Me)(PMe3)Cl(NBut)], [Mo(η-C5H4Me)(PMe3)-Me(NBut)], [Mo(η-C5H4Me)(PMe3)2(NBut)]+A–(A = Cl or BF4), [Mo(η-C5H4Me)(PMe2Ph)Cl-(NBut)], isomers of [Mo(η-C5H4R)(η-C3H5)(NBut)](R = Me or Pri), and [Mo(η-C5H4Me)(η-C2H4)-(σ-C3H5)(NBut)]. The crystal structure of [{MoCl3(µ-Cl)(NBut)}2] has been determined. These compounds include the first or rare examples of combinations of ligands with the imido group, for example, imido η3-allyl derivatives.
